Output 87b9394106cfabdd780eba9032d6446d3e0eda4320a287a4179016a39aebc3af:0

value
705856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d389ee7ad49b116fe2b319029c3733649cf616c OP_EQUAL
address
3D78DbiQYqhmFzBNPeFFphTxP5KrEq4ZmN
transaction
87b9394106cfabdd780eba9032d6446d3e0eda4320a287a4179016a39aebc3af
spent
true